Web8 jun. 2015 · Add a gravel or limestone paver base to the excavated area and spread it to form a 6-inch-deep layer over the entire patio space. If you're using a limestone paver … Web28 aug. 2024 · Concrete sand is the proper sand for laying a foundational base for a concrete paver installation. It is extremely coarse sand so it can be compacted uniformly and allows for adequate water drainage. Concrete sand will lift slightly into the joints of the pavers when they are being leveled, locking them into place.

Then, before you break ground, contact your local utilities to make sure you don't disturb any underground lines, pipes, or cables. Web20 mei 2024 · Press them into the sand as you lay them. Lay the pavers as closely together as you can and use a rubber mallet to seat them into the sand. Use a small level to check the bricks in 2 directions, and use at least a 6-foot level for a drainage slope. 9. Spread a layer of sand over the bricks.
